EDITORS COMMENTS
In this colour lithograph, we witness the dramatic moment when "The shadow of Death came down upon Hector". Created by William Heath Robinson, this print is a visual representation of an intense scene from Homer's epic poem, The Iliad. Robinson's skillful use of color and composition draws us into the ancient world of Greek mythology. The image depicts the Trojan hero Hector standing defiantly against his formidable adversary, Achilles. As the shadow looms over him, it symbolizes the imminent doom that awaits Hector on the battlefield. This artwork serves as an illustration for Stories from The Iliad or The Siege of Troy told by Jeanie Lang.
